Local boundary conditions in nonlocal hyperelasticity via heterogeneous horizons
A new Sobolev-space theory for nonlocal gradients with space-dependent horizons is developed, including trace, Poincare, and existence results for nonlocal hyperelasticity with local boundary conditions.
